Private site invisible to search engines?

Goal: a web site that is relatively private. Viewers will find the
pages through links in e-mails. We will make no effort to have the
pages appear in any search engine; if it is possible to disable
listing at search engines (should they be found) we'd like to do that.
Obviously, once the e-mail is sent out, someone could put a link
somewhere public, and Google could find it. But if nobody posts a
link, how would any search engine find it?
Where can I learn more about this- whether it is possible, and how to
disable listing by search engines? Thanks
